刷题首页
题库
高中信息
题干
如果x >5,那么y=2x,否则y=x2+1。下面表述正确的语句是( )
A.If x>5 Then y="2x" Else y=x2+1
B.If x>5 Then y="x*x+1" Else y=2*x
C.If x>5 Then y="2*x" Else y=x*x+1
D.If x<5 Then y="x*x+1" Else y=2*x
上一题
下一题
0.99难度 选择题 更新时间:2016-01-05 01:23:51
答案(点此获取答案解析)
同类题1
该同学有个好朋友也在学习VB,想要这个程序的源文件,这个同学应该把程序为下列哪种文件格式发给好友?( )
A.FRM
B.JPG
C.EXE
D.PSD
同类题2
在Visual Basic中,表达式"20"+"08"的值是( )
A.28
B.False
C.20+08
D.2008
同类题3
1.判断抛物线y=ax2+bx+c与x轴是否有交点的一种算法是:首先输入三个系数a,b,c的值,然后计算D值,D="b*b-4*a*c" ,如果D<0,则抛物线与x轴无交点,否则抛物线与x轴有交点。这个算法的描述方式是(___)。
A. 伪代码 B. 流程图 C. 自然语言 D. 计算机程序
2.在上题中,解决问题的算法基本结构是(___)。
A. 框架结构 B. 顺序结构 C. 循环结构 D. 选择结构
同类题4
有一个由4000个整数构成的顺序表,假定表中的元素已经按升序排列,采用二分查找定位一个元素。则最多需要( )次比较就能确定是否存在所查找的元素。
A.11次
B.12次
C.13次
D.14次
同类题5
数学中有斐波那契数列,现已知前8项是1,1,2,3,5,8,13,21,设计如下VB程序求第n项的值:
Dim a(1 to 1000)as long,n as integer
n=Val(text1.text):学+科+网
a(1)=1:a(2)=1
For i="3" to n
a(i)=a(i-1)+a(i-2)
Next i
Label1.caption ="斐波那契的第"&str(n)&"是"&a(n)
该程序用到下列哪种算法?
A.枚举算法
B.解析算法
C.排序算法
D.查找算法
相关知识点
算法理论
算法及算法的表示方法